CronExpression OR子句在日期字段中?

时间:2012-01-06 14:43:28

标签: java quartz-scheduler cronexpression

你好我有一个简单的cronexpression

 0 00 00 30 * ?

30岁的地方每个月30日。这不会返回二月,所以我想要一个像月份字段的OR子句,但我还没有看到如何做到这一点。准确地说,我想要一个能给我每月30日或最后一天的表达。

2 个答案:

答案 0 :(得分:0)

The Quartz documentation给出答案:“日期”字段应为L,为“最后”。

(很好的补充,我希望vixie-cron也有这个)

答案 1 :(得分:0)

由于“L”不能满足您的需求,因此请使用与这项工作相关的多个触发器。

E.g。 “0 0 0 30 JAN,MAR,APR,MAY,JUN,JUL,AUG,SEP,OCT,NOV,DEC?”和“0 0 0 L FEB?”